09.08.2025 22:54, Kirill Reshke пишет: > On Thu, 7 Aug 2025 at 21:36, Aleksander Alekseev > <aleksan...@tigerdata.com> wrote: > >> Perhaps there was a good >> reason to update the VM *before* creating WAL records I'm unaware of. > > Looks like 503c730 intentionally does it this way; however, I have not > yet fully understood the reasoning behind it.
I repeat: there was no intention. Neither in commit message, nor in discussion about. There was intention to move visibilitymap_clear under heap page lock and into critical section, but there were no any word about logging. I believe, it was just an unfortunate oversight that the change is made before logging. -- regards Yura Sokolov aka funny-falcon